Product owner vs product manager. The Skills of Product Owners vs. Product Managers. The career path of a product manager often runs through Marketing, but can start from an engineering role; product owners often have a background as an individual technical contributor.

The underlying difference between both positions is that a product manager is a strategic role, while a product owner is more tactical. Whereas a product manager might drive the strategic development of a product, the product owner ensures that the team perform the tasks necessary to drive that strategy. Jul 16, 2021 · The product manager is a wider-reaching role. This is the person focused on overall product strategy, collecting feedback, discovering the problems facing the business and its customers, and figuring out how to bring vetted solutions into reality. The PM generally leads and works across teams to get the product designed, built, and launched. While a product manager defines the direction of the product through research, vision-setting, alignment, and prioritization, the product owner should work more closely with the development team to execute against the goals that the product manager helps to define. But responsibilities can shift a bit when team makeups and practices shift. Where the product manager focuses on long-term vision, the product owner worries more about how to translate that vision into reality. Where the product owner is interested in optimizing the day-to-day work of the development team, the product manager is focused on the product roadmap.
